Unfortunately there still hasn't been any change on this.
The data is still not accurate. For example: Square -612|-278 From today worldmap datafile: 2557667|-612|-278|0|0|0|0|9|18|7|24 TerrainCombatTypeID = 7 From the terrain combat data XML file: <terraincombat><terraincombattype id="7">Plains</terraincombattype></terraincombat> So it should be on plains but in the game this square is a Small hill. |

I'm running into this issue now, so I'll add what I've found.
The issue seems to stem from a tile having a TerrainSpecificTypeID = 4 in the datafile_worldmap.txt. This ID is not present in the datafile_terrain.xml. Now, inside datafile_towns.xml, it might be possible to determine the underlying tile TerrainSpecificTypeID by using the terrainoveralltype ID. However, this too is inconsistent since there are some values of "4" for that ID attribute. For now, I'm treating all TerrainSpecificTypeID = 4 as unknowns, and will build an errata to supplement my work. However, I too would like to request that the datafile_worldmap.txt file be investigated to replace these unknowns with their proper IDs. Presently, there are 25,388 tiles with this unknown TerrainSpecificTypeID.

This is because of the relocation spell, which takes some of the underlying terrain stats with it.
You can find all these by comparing the default terrain for each terrain type, with the terrain data for the square. |
